LITTLE ROCK, Ark. (AP) - Olin and Paula Branstetter never grew tired of flying.
The former Oklahoma lawmaker and his wife cruised over the North Pole when they were in their 50s. Their family says they took to the sky about 10 times a month, even as Olin crept into his 80s.
So why their plane fell out of the sky in central Arkansas last week remains a mystery. The couple died in the crash Thursday, as did the two Oklahoma State University basketball coaches who were on board.
Federal investigators have said weather didn't play a role in the crash near Perryville, Ark. Women's basketball coach Kurt Budke and assistant coach Miranda Serna planned to scout two prospective recruits in Little Rock, about 45 miles to the southeast.
